How can decentralized teams effectively navigate conflict resolution when faced with differing opinions and perspectives in a virtual setting?
Decentralized teams can effectively navigate conflict resolution in a virtual setting by establishing clear communication channels and protocols for addressing conflicts. Encouraging open and respectful dialogue among team members can help to identify and address differing opinions and perspectives. Utilizing technology tools such as video conferencing and collaboration platforms can facilitate virtual discussions and problem-solving. Implementing a structured conflict resolution process that includes active listening, empathy, and compromise can help teams reach mutually beneficial solutions. Regular check-ins and team-building activities can also help foster trust and understanding among team members, leading to more effective conflict resolution.
